That’s right, we're at it again! We jumped aboard the Antares 44i this past weekend. We did a quick provision trip to get us through 5 days and we are currently headed south! Only this time it’s a little different. The Captain of the vessel, John, is only sailing with us for 5 out of the 15 days. I know, crazy! He must really trust us and feel safe leaving his floating home in our hands. So we plan to play around Key West of course and possibly head off to the Dry Tortugas for a week before heading back up the Keys to Ft. Lauderdale where we will meet up with John again later in the month.
At this very moment we're making our first and rather long passage of 90 miles from St. Pete to Fort Myers. We'll drop anchor for a night before making another 100 mile hop to Boca Chica military base where the Captain will catch a flight. We'll then provision for 10 days and hopefully head west for the Dry Tortugas! This is an amazing opportinuty for us as we'll get a chance to see what it’s like aboard a catamaran with it just being our little family. I hope that it helps us make our final decision on a catamaran VS mono hail. Wish us luck!
